Our client is an award winning ASX Listed Financial Services business. As a Face-to-Face B2C Sales and Education Specialist you will visit client sites to engage and educate employee groups on the benefits of Financial Products - Novated Leasing and Salary Packaging solutions.
These sites are mostly existing relationships that are fully pre-qualified. You will need a strong sales background and have demonstrated experience being able to work autonomously, managing your own day / KPIs and deliverables. This will require an experienced salesperson with a proven track record.
The Role:
* To contact client sites and arrange presentations, workshops and consultations
* To conduct presentations, workshops and consultations at client sites
* To identify customer needs and match with relevant salary packaging / leasing and financial products and services
* To establish and manage relationships with key client stakeholders with view to increase awareness in region
* To identify opportunities in the region/client base to increase awareness and sales and leasing lead volumes
